In American Pickers: Best Of season 2 episode 8, entitled "Great American Rides", Mike Wolfe and Frank Fritz are on the hunt for rare motorcycles and vintage automobile finds in some of the most unexpected places across the United States.

As expert "pickers", the dynamic duo scour the countryside in search of hidden gems tucked away in barns, sheds, and garages. In this episode, the focus is on unusual and rare vehicles - the kind of rides that turn heads and generate a cult following.

The episode kicks off in Illinois, where the guys visit a barn filled with classic cars and motorcycles. Among the treasures they uncover are a 1946 Harley Davidson Knucklehead, a 1955 Chevy Bel Air, and a 1932 Ford Roadster. The owner of the collection is reluctant to part with his beloved bikes and cars, but Mike and Frank work their charm and manage to strike a deal.

Next up, the pickers head to a motorcycle museum in Iowa. The museum boasts an impressive collection of rare motorcycles, including a 1911 Harley Davidson, a 1914 Indian Single, and a 1938 Crocker. Mike and Frank geek out over the vintage choppers and chat with the museum curator about the history of American motorcycle culture.

The guys then hit the road and head to a remote ranch in Oklahoma, where they stumble upon a rusted-out old car in a field. But upon closer inspection, they realize they've struck gold - the car is a 1936 Auburn Speedster, one of only 100 ever made. The owner of the ranch is initially hesitant to part with the Speedster, but Mike and Frank work their magic and convince him to sell.

From Oklahoma, the pickers travel to Texas, where they visit a collector with a passion for military vehicles. They check out an impressive assortment of tanks, army trucks, and jeeps, and even get to take a ride in a vintage WWII-era vehicle.

The episode wraps up back in Illinois, where the guys discover a hidden cache of vintage motorcycles in a garage. Among the bikes are a 1937 Harley Davidson Knucklehead, a 1950 Indian Chief, and a 1968 Triumph Bonneville. Mike and Frank are like kids in a candy store as they inspect each bike and haggle with the owner over prices.
